WebThe most common symptom of hip tendonitis is hip pain that happens gradually. It can also cause tenderness at the point in the hip where the tendon is. People with iliopsoas tendonitis often feel pain in the front of their hip. If hip tendonitis goes untreated, the pain can get worse over time. Hip tendonitis can cause mobility issues, meaning ... WebSep 21, 2024 · Summary. Enthesitis is the medical term for inflammation of one or more entheses. These are sites at which tendons and ligaments attach to bones. Enthesitis can cause symptoms such as joint pain ...
